Spectramedx is seeking an experienced and results-driven Territory Sales Manager to join our team. In this role, you will be responsible for promoting and selling a portfolio of advanced respiratory and patient monitoring products to hospitals and healthcare institutions across British Columbia and Alberta.
We're looking for a strategic sales professional with a strong background in medical device sales -- ideally in respiratory care -- who thrives in a consultative, solutions-oriented environment. You will be expected to build strong relationships with clinical and procurement stakeholders, identify new opportunities, and drive growth across the territory.
Responsibilities
Develop and execute a strategic territory business plan to meet or exceed sales targets and drive market expansion.
Build and maintain strong relationships with key stakeholders, including clinicians, department heads, and procurement teams within hospitals and healthcare facilities.
Conduct professional product presentations and in-service demonstrations, effectively communicating the clinical and operational benefits of our respiratory and monitoring solutions.
Stay informed on industry trends, competitor activity, and market developments to strategically position Spectramedx's offerings.
Partner closely with marketing and product teams to relay customer feedback and help identify new opportunities for growth and innovation.
Represent Spectramedx at conferences, trade shows, and industry events to enhance visibility and build new business connections.
Maintain up-to-date and accurate records of sales activities, customer interactions, and opportunities using CRM tools.
Qualifications
Registered Respiratory Therapist (RT) with direct hospital experience in Canada
(mandatory).
Proven track record of success in medical device sales or a related field, with a minimum of 2 years of experience.
Strong understanding of the healthcare industry and medical device market.
Excellent communication, presentation, and negotiation skills.
Ability to build and maintain long-term customer relationships.
Self-motivated, goal-oriented, and able to work independently as well as part of a team.
Proficiency in CRM software and Microsoft Office Suite.
Willingness to travel within the designated territory as required.
